import 'package:permission_handler/permission_handler.dart'; class NotificationUtil { NotificationUtil._(); static Future hasNotificationPermission() async { final status = await Permission.notification.status; return status.isGranted; } static Future requestNotificationPermission() async { final status = await Permission.locationWhenInUse.request(); return status.isGranted; } }